The first Green County Sheriff took office in 1838. A temporary jail was used at the American House which was located in what is known as the White Block Building on the southwest corner of the square in Monroe. The first County Jail, which was built out of logs prior to 1855, was destroyed by fire. This jail wa

s located next to the local brewery and news reports indicate the brewery was saved from the adjoining flames by the efforts of citizens who kept the roof moistened with the contents from large beer vats inside. That same year, proposals for a new jail were received and a jail made of stone was approved for construction on the same site which is now known as the Jailhouse Tap Tavern. The Jail House Tap is located about two blocks southwest of the downtown area. In 1959, the Sheriff's Department/Jail at the current location on the east side of Monroe was built to house up to 20 inmates. In 1980, a portion of the 1959 structure was torn down and an addition was added which increased the holding capacity to 70 beds. SHERIFF KILLED IN LINE OF DUTY

One Green County Sheriff was killed in the line of duty on May 3, 1919 when Sheriff Matt Solbraa responded to a report of a man held up in a farm house seven miles north of Monroe. Reports of the incident indicated a homeless man had shot and killed a farmer and the Sheriff responded to the scene and confronted the man. ordering him to drop his weapon. The man fired and fatally injured Sheriff Solbraa. Sheriff Solbraa's name is inscribed in the Wisconsin Law Enforcement Memorial on the ground of the Capitol at Madison, WI and the National Law Enforcement Officers Memorial in Washington, D. C. Department Summary


Green County is comprised of 16 townships, five villages and two cities. The Sheriff's Department is responsible for patroling the areas of the county that do not provide their own enforcement. This includes the towns of Adams, Albany, Brooklyn, Cadiz, Clarno, Decatur, Exeter, Jefferson, Jordan, Monroe, Mt. Pleasant, New Glarus, Spring Grove, Sylvester, Washington, York and the Village of Browntown. In addition, the Sheriff's Department provides protection to the villages of Albany, Brooklyn, Monticello and New Glarus when the officers from these agencies are off duty. The Sheriff's Department/Jail is located at 2827 6th Street, which houses the 911 County Communication Center, a 70-bed jail and other Department-related offices. The operation of the Department is divided into several divisions consisting of Administration, Communications, Jail, Patrol, Detective, Clerical, Special Units, and Support Staff.

302.41 Care of prisoners. Whenever there is a prisoner in any jail there shall be at least one person of the same s*x on duty who is wholly responsible to the sheriff or keeper for the custody, cleanliness, food and care of such prisoner.
History: 1975 c. 94; 1989 a. 31 s. 1665; Stats. 1989 s. 302.41.
This section does not conflict with the Wisconsin Fair Employment Act. Discussing a “bona fide occupational qualification” under Title VII of the federal 1964 Civil Rights Act. Counties must comply with this section when they can do so without conflict with Title VII. 70 Atty. Gen. 202.
